IPTC and XMP are both metadata standards used to describe and organize digital media files. IPTC was developed earlier and is more focused on news and media industry needs, while XMP is a more flexible and extensible standard created by Adobe. XMP can embed IPTC metadata within its structure, allowing for compatibility and interoperability between the two standards.
